Potential Causes of Uneven Pavement

Uneven pavement defects can happen anywhere and can be due to many causes. They can occur in construction zones that are not properly blocked off, where highway construction has not been completed, or areas that are susceptible to wear because of overuse or weathering. More potential causes of uneven pavements include, but are not limited to, the following:

  • Improperly laid slabs
  • Erosion
  • Wear and tear
  • Lack of signs
  • Poor road maintenance

Driving on an uneven surface or switching lanes between uneven surfaces can be enough to cause a car accident. The shift in surface height can cause an unexpected change in tire direction, tire damage, a blowout, and even axel damage. Any of these circumstances, even if they only affect the driver for a moment, can cause an accident, injury, and damage.
